Bulls say

Alpine Income Property Trust Inc. has reported a slight increase in the percentage of annualized base rent (ABR) derived from its top two tenants, Dick's Sporting Goods and Lowe's, indicating a stable and reliable tenant base that contributes to revenue stability. The company has also improved its guidance for fiscal year 2025, anticipating investments of $200-$230 million, which reflects growing confidence in its ability to identify and capitalize on lucrative opportunities. Furthermore, the firm has demonstrated a commitment to returning capital to shareholders through its share repurchase program, having repurchased over 272,000 shares, underscoring its strong financial standing and strategic financial management.

Bears say

Alpine Income Property Trust Inc. is facing a negative outlook primarily due to its declining proportion of investment-grade (IG) assets in the adjusted base rent (ABR), which could lead to heightened exit cash cap rates returning to historical levels significantly above current rates. Additionally, the company's ongoing efforts to minimize its exposure to Walgreens, which has dropped to approximately 6.6% of ABR, may not be sufficient to stabilize revenue streams in the face of shifting market dynamics. Lastly, the increased leverage risk associated with fluctuating interest rates could adversely affect returns to common shareholders, compounding the challenges presented by a potentially prolonged economic downturn and general market volatility in commercial real estate.
